Starting kaffaarah fasts at the beginning of an Islamic month

Answered as per Hanafi Fiqh by Muftionline.co.za

Q: I have a question regarding kaffarah for accidentally killing someone. I read a recent post of yours saying that you have to fast for two months consecutively.

My question is, does one start fasting from the first of the month (so, assuming we follow the hijri calendar, fasting could be for 58-60 days if there are 29/30 days in the month) or can one start anytime and fast for 60 days?

Bismillaah

A: Both are right.
